编程题
### 问题描述
小蓝这天在研究干电池。他有一串数量为 $N$ 的干电池 $s_1,s_2,\ldots,s_N$ ,每个干电池的初始电量都为正整数。小蓝可以对每个干电池执行三种操作,将 $s_i$ 加上 $1$、将 $s_i$ 减去 $1$ 或者保持不变。
小蓝拿出了从蓝桥工厂买来的标准电池,电量为 $Y$ 。小蓝想知道,在经过任意操作后,最多能得到多少个与标准电池电量一样的干电池。
### 输入格式
输入的第一行包含一个整数 $N$($1\leq N \leq 10^5$),表示有多少电池
输入的第二行包含 $N$ 个整数 $s_1,s_2,\ldots,s_N$($1\leq s_i \leq 10^5$),表示电池的初始电力值。
### 输出格式
输出一个整数,表示能够得到的最多等于 $Y$ 的元素个数。
### 样例输入
```
5
2 3 2 4 1
```
### 样例输出
```
4
```